There’s something undeniably comforting about a creamy, spicy pasta dish that comes together in one pot. That’s exactly what inspired me to whip up this One-Pot Honey Butter Buffalo Chicken & Mozzarella Pasta. It’s got everything I love—tender bites of chicken, melty mozzarella cheese, a tangy kick of buffalo sauce, and that subtle hint of sweetness from honey butter that rounds it all out. The best part? You don’t need a sink full of dishes to make it happen.

I created this recipe on a night when I was craving something rich and satisfying but didn’t want to spend hours cooking. It’s a weeknight hero, packed with bold flavor and just the right amount of heat. Whether you’re cooking for yourself, your family, or feeding a crowd, this pasta dish hits all the marks—comfort food with flair, made fast and easy.
Why You’ll Love This One-Pot Honey Butter Buffalo Chicken & Mozzarella Pasta
- One-pot magic: Minimal cleanup means more time to relax after dinner.
- Sweet and spicy harmony: The honey butter and buffalo sauce balance each other perfectly.
- Creamy and cheesy: Melty mozzarella gives that irresistible stretch and richness.
- Protein-packed: With chunks of chicken breast, it’s hearty and satisfying.
- Quick weeknight meal: Ready in under 30 minutes, perfect for busy evenings.
- Customizable: You can dial up the heat, swap in different cheeses, or add veggies.
What Kind of Pasta Works Best for One-Pot Honey Butter Buffalo Chicken & Mozzarella Pasta?
For this recipe, I love using short, sturdy pasta like rigatoni, penne, or cavatappi—like the one in the photo. These shapes hold onto the creamy, spicy sauce beautifully, with all those ridges and curves soaking up every drop of flavor. If you want a slightly more delicate bite, elbow macaroni is a good choice too. Since everything cooks in one pot, you want a pasta that holds its structure well and doesn’t turn mushy—so skip angel hair or anything too thin.
Options for Substitutions
This recipe is forgiving and flexible. Here are a few ways to switch it up depending on what you have on hand:
- Chicken: Swap for shredded rotisserie chicken to save time, or use ground chicken or turkey if you want a leaner twist.
- Mozzarella cheese: You can substitute with shredded cheddar, Monterey Jack, or even a blend if you want something sharper or more melty.
- Buffalo sauce: Don’t have any? Mix hot sauce with a little melted butter for a quick DIY version.
- Honey butter: If you’re out of honey, maple syrup works in a pinch. And vegan butter is great if you’re going dairy-free.
- Pasta: Gluten-free or whole wheat pasta works well—just keep an eye on cook time as it may vary slightly.
- Add-ins: Stir in spinach, roasted red peppers, or sautéed onions to make it extra hearty or sneak in some veggies.
Ingredients for One-Pot Honey Butter Buffalo Chicken & Mozzarella Pasta
Each ingredient in this dish plays a role in building that crave-worthy sweet, spicy, and cheesy flavor combo. Here’s what you’ll need and why it matters:
- Butter – This is where the honey butter magic begins. It gives the sauce a rich base and helps mellow out the spice.
- Honey – Adds just the right amount of sweetness to balance the tang and heat from the buffalo sauce.
- Chicken breast – Tender chunks of chicken give this dish its hearty bite and make it a complete, filling meal.
- Buffalo sauce – The star of the flavor show, buffalo sauce brings the heat and zing that makes this pasta pop.
- Mozzarella cheese – Creamy, stretchy, and melty—mozzarella turns the sauce into something dreamy and comforting.
- Pasta (like cavatappi, penne, or rigatoni) – A sturdy, ridged pasta that grabs onto the sauce and holds its shape well in a one-pot cook.
- Heavy cream or milk (optional) – For those who like it extra creamy, a splash of dairy adds silkiness to the sauce.
- Salt and pepper – Simple but essential to enhance all the other flavors.
- Garlic powder or minced garlic (optional) – A touch of garlic adds depth and rounds out the sauce beautifully.

Step 1: Sear the Chicken
Start by cutting your chicken breast into bite-sized chunks. Heat a large pot or deep skillet over medium-high heat and melt about 1 tablespoon of butter. Add the chicken pieces, season with salt, pepper, and garlic powder if using, and sear until golden brown on the outside and cooked through—about 5–7 minutes. Remove the chicken from the pot and set aside.
Step 2: Build the Honey Butter Buffalo Sauce
In the same pot, lower the heat to medium. Add the rest of the butter and let it melt. Stir in honey and buffalo sauce, whisking gently until combined. Let it bubble slightly so the flavors blend and the sauce thickens just a bit—this should take about 2 minutes.
Step 3: Add the Pasta and Liquid
Pour your dry pasta directly into the sauce. Add enough water or chicken broth to just cover the pasta—about 3 to 4 cups depending on your pasta type. Stir everything together and bring to a gentle boil.
Step 4: Simmer Until Pasta is Cooked
Reduce heat to a simmer and cook the pasta uncovered, stirring occasionally to prevent sticking. It should take around 10–12 minutes depending on the shape. Most of the liquid will be absorbed, and the pasta will be tender but not mushy.
Step 5: Stir in the Chicken and Cheese
Once the pasta is cooked and the sauce has thickened, return the cooked chicken to the pot. Turn off the heat and stir in the shredded mozzarella cheese. The cheese will melt into the sauce, making it luxuriously creamy. If you’d like it extra rich, you can also add a splash of cream or milk at this stage.
Step 6: Finish and Serve
Taste and adjust seasoning as needed. Spoon into bowls while hot, and feel free to top with extra buffalo sauce, chopped parsley, or even blue cheese crumbles if you’re feeling wild. That’s it—dinner’s ready!
How Long to Cook One-Pot Honey Butter Buffalo Chicken & Mozzarella Pasta
This entire recipe—from searing to stirring in the cheese—takes about 25 to 30 minutes total. Here’s the breakdown:
- Chicken cooking time: 5–7 minutes to get it golden and cooked through
- Simmering pasta: 10–12 minutes depending on the shape
- Final assembly with cheese: 2–3 minutes to melt and combine
Because everything cooks in the same pot, you’re shaving off extra time from cleanup and keeping all that flavor in one place.
Tips for Perfect One-Pot Honey Butter Buffalo Chicken & Mozzarella Pasta
- Sear the chicken properly: Don’t overcrowd the pan, or it will steam instead of getting that nice golden crust. A good sear adds extra flavor.
- Use enough liquid: Make sure the pasta is just barely covered when you add it to the pot. Too much and it’ll be soupy, too little and it won’t cook evenly.
- Stir occasionally: Especially toward the end of cooking. This keeps the pasta from sticking and helps create that creamy texture.
- Add cheese off the heat: Once the pot is off the burner, stir in the mozzarella. This keeps it gooey and smooth instead of stringy or clumpy.
- Adjust the heat level: If you’re spice-sensitive, cut the buffalo sauce with a bit more honey or a splash of cream to mellow it out.
- Choose the right pot: A wide, deep skillet or Dutch oven works best so everything cooks evenly and stirs easily.
- Taste before serving: Every buffalo sauce is a little different—some are saltier or spicier than others, so taste and adjust at the end.
Watch Out for These Mistakes While Cooking
Even though this dish is straightforward, there are a few easy missteps that can affect the final result:
- Overcooking the pasta: Since it’s simmering in the sauce, it can go from al dente to mushy fast. Start checking a minute or two before the suggested cook time.
- Adding cheese too early: If the mozzarella goes in while the pot is still over heat, it might separate or get stringy. Always stir it in after turning off the burner.
- Using too much buffalo sauce: It’s tempting, but adding more than called for without balancing it out with honey or dairy can overpower the dish.
- Not seasoning the chicken: Salt, pepper, and garlic give your chicken flavor from the start—don’t skip this step.
- Not enough liquid for pasta: Eyeball carefully; the pasta needs to be fully submerged when cooking or it won’t cook evenly.
- Crowding the chicken: This causes it to steam instead of sear. Brown it in batches if needed for best texture.
- Forgetting to taste at the end: Buffalo sauces vary—taste before serving and tweak with salt, honey, or more cheese if needed.
- Using the wrong pot: A shallow or small pan won’t cook the pasta evenly. Go for a wide, deep skillet or Dutch oven.
What to Serve With One-Pot Honey Butter Buffalo Chicken & Mozzarella Pasta
Side Salad with Ranch or Blue Cheese
The crisp freshness balances the rich, spicy pasta beautifully—and ranch or blue cheese dressing ties in the buffalo wing vibes.
Garlic Bread
Buttery, garlicky, and perfect for scooping up extra sauce from the bowl.
Dill Pickles or Pickled Veggies
A tangy, acidic crunch helps cut through the creamy sauce.
Grilled Corn on the Cob
Sweet, slightly smoky corn is an ideal contrast to the heat of the dish.
Crispy Roasted Potatoes
Hearty, crispy potatoes are a great addition if you’re feeding a bigger group or want extra comfort food vibes.
Celery and Carrot Sticks
Keep it classic with crunchy, cooling veggies—just like with wings.
Sparkling Lemonade or Iced Tea
A refreshing sip with some citrus zing balances the bold flavors of the pasta.
A Cold Beer
If you’re serving adults, a light lager or wheat beer pairs perfectly with the buffalo heat and creamy cheese.
Storage Instructions
Leftovers of One-Pot Honey Butter Buffalo Chicken & Mozzarella Pasta store surprisingly well—just be sure to seal them up tight to keep the flavor and texture on point.
- Refrigerator: Transfer cooled leftovers into an airtight container and refrigerate for up to 4 days.
- Reheating: Warm it in a saucepan or microwave with a splash of milk or broth to bring back that creamy consistency. Stir halfway to ensure even heating.
- Freezer: This dish can be frozen, though mozzarella may become a bit grainy upon reheating. Freeze in individual portions for up to 2 months. Thaw overnight in the fridge before reheating gently.
Tip: Avoid freezing if you’ve used cream in the final mix, as it may separate when defrosted.
Estimated Nutrition (per serving, based on 6 servings)
While the exact numbers will vary depending on the brands and portions used, here’s a general idea of what you’re getting in one hearty serving:
- Calories: ~580
- Protein: ~32g
- Fat: ~25g
- Saturated Fat: ~11g
- Carbohydrates: ~54g
- Fiber: ~2g
- Sugar: ~8g
- Sodium: ~980mg
- Calcium: ~200mg
This pasta dish is definitely indulgent and satisfying, making it great for a comfort-food night or post-workout reward.
Frequently Asked Questions
What kind of buffalo sauce should I use?
Any store-bought buffalo wing sauce will do—Frank’s RedHot is a popular choice. Just make sure it’s a wing sauce (already blended with butter), or add a bit of melted butter to regular hot sauce to make your own.
Can I make this ahead of time?
You can prep the chicken and sauce in advance, but pasta is best cooked fresh to avoid mushiness. If you must make it ahead, slightly undercook the pasta, then reheat gently with a splash of liquid.
How do I make it less spicy?
Use a mild buffalo sauce or cut the amount in half. Add more honey, cream, or even a dollop of sour cream to cool it down without losing flavor.
Is this recipe gluten-free?
Not as written, but you can use gluten-free pasta and double-check that your buffalo sauce and broth are gluten-free too.
Can I use pre-cooked or leftover chicken?
Yes! Shredded rotisserie chicken or chopped leftovers work great. Add them just before stirring in the cheese so they don’t overcook.
What cheese can I use instead of mozzarella?
Cheddar, Monterey Jack, Colby, or a shredded blend will all work. Mozzarella gives you that signature stretch, but others add a sharper punch.
Can I add vegetables to this dish?
Absolutely—spinach, bell peppers, or broccoli make great additions. Add heartier veggies while the pasta cooks, and stir in delicate greens at the end.
Is this kid-friendly?
It depends on the kid! If they’re sensitive to spice, tone down the buffalo sauce and go heavy on the honey and cheese to create a milder version.
Conclusion
One-Pot Honey Butter Buffalo Chicken & Mozzarella Pasta is the kind of recipe that turns a regular night into something special with very little effort. It’s bold, rich, creamy, spicy-sweet, and wonderfully satisfying—all in one skillet. Whether you’re craving comfort food or need a go-to weeknight dinner that delivers on flavor and simplicity, this dish is here for you.
It’s the kind of meal that gets people leaning back in their chairs saying, “Okay, that was really good.” And the best part? One pot, minimal mess, maximum flavor. What’s not to love?

One-Pot Honey Butter Buffalo Chicken & Mozzarella Pasta
- Total Time: 30 minutes
- Yield: 6 servings 1x
Description
Craving something spicy, creamy, and irresistibly cheesy—all in one pan? This One-Pot Honey Butter Buffalo Chicken & Mozzarella Pasta is your new go-to comfort food recipe. Juicy chicken, zesty buffalo sauce, sweet honey butter, and melty mozzarella come together with tender pasta in a bold, saucy combo that’s ready in just 30 minutes. It’s perfect for a quick weeknight dinner, meal prep, or an indulgent but easy weekend treat. Great for fans of spicy pasta, easy dinner recipes, and bold food ideas that don’t hold back on flavor.
Ingredients
- 2 tablespoons butter (divided)
- 2 tablespoons honey
- 1 lb chicken breast, cut into bite-sized pieces
- Salt and pepper to taste
- 1 teaspoon garlic powder (optional)
- 1/2 cup buffalo sauce (adjust to taste)
- 12 oz pasta (cavatappi, penne, or rigatoni)
- 3 1/2 cups water or chicken broth (enough to cover pasta)
- 1 1/2 cups shredded mozzarella cheese
- Splash of heavy cream or milk (optional)
Instructions
- Heat 1 tablespoon butter in a large pot or deep skillet over medium-high heat. Add chicken, season with salt, pepper, and garlic powder, and sear until golden brown and cooked through (5–7 minutes). Remove and set aside.
- Lower heat to medium and add remaining butter. Stir in honey and buffalo sauce. Let bubble for 1–2 minutes.
- Add pasta to the pot and pour in enough water or broth to just cover the noodles.
- Bring to a boil, then reduce heat and simmer uncovered, stirring occasionally, for 10–12 minutes until pasta is tender and most of the liquid is absorbed.
- Return cooked chicken to the pot. Turn off heat, then stir in mozzarella and optional cream until melted and creamy.
- Taste and adjust seasoning if needed. Serve hot with your favorite toppings or sides.
- Prep Time: 10 minutes
- Cook Time: 20 minutes